Bug#865560: RFS: gexiv2/0.10.6-1
hurray! >I didn't notice this when I ran the tests because I already have >libexiv2-dev installed. I see now that I could have run the tests in an >sbuild schroot. another issue fixed by a good testsuite! however not quite ready http://debomatic-amd64.debian.net/distribution#unstable/gexiv2/0.10.6-1/autopkgtest G.
Bug#865560: RFS: gexiv2/0.10.6-1
On Mon, Jun 26, 2017 at 09:06:19PM +, Gianfranco Costamagna wrote: > >I am looking for a sponsor for my package "gexiv2" > > I sponsored in deferred/10, but I have some questions/nitpicks: > 1) you can consider having a debian/clean file instead of overriding dh_clean I will do this. > 2) did you test/rebuild reverse-dependencies? I did, and they build and run fine, but... > 3) please fix testsuite > http://debomatic-amd64.debian.net/distribution#unstable/gexiv2/0.10.6-1/autopkgtest For #3 - Thank you for catching this. This could have broken the build of reverse dependencies. This version adds "Requires.private: exiv2" to the pkg-config file to make static linking easier. It turns out that doing this means that the .pc file won't work without exiv2.pc also installed, even when not static linking. I will add libexiv2-dev as a dependency to libgexiv2-dev. I didn't notice this when I ran the tests because I already have libexiv2-dev installed. I see now that I could have run the tests in an sbuild schroot.
Bug#865560: RFS: gexiv2/0.10.6-1
Package: sponsorship-requests Severity: normal Dear mentors, I am looking for a sponsor for my package "gexiv2" * Package name: gexiv2 Version : 0.10.6-1 Upstream Author : Jens Georg * URL : https://wiki.gnome.org/Projects/gexiv2 * License : GPL-2+ Section : libs It builds those binary packages: gir1.2-gexiv2-0.10 - GObject-based wrapper around the Exiv2 library - introspection da libgexiv2-2 - GObject-based wrapper around the Exiv2 library libgexiv2-dev - GObject-based wrapper around the Exiv2 library - development file libgexiv2-doc - GObject-based wrapper around the Exiv2 library - documentation To access further information about this package, please visit the following URL: https://mentors.debian.net/package/gexiv2 Alternatively, one can download the package with dget using this command: dget -x https://mentors.debian.net/debian/pool/main/g/gexiv2/gexiv2_0.10.6-1.dsc More information about gexiv2 can be obtained from https://wiki.gnome.org/Projects/gexiv2. Changes since the last upload: * New upstream version 0.10.6 * Add package libgexiv2-doc. Contains GTK-Doc API documentation for libgexiv2. * Add patch Fix-documentation-typos.patch. Fixes various typos in the API documentation. * Update debian/watch to version 4 * Use DEP-14 branch names. Add debian/gbp.conf to set branch defaults. * Drop upstreamed patches * Add Build-Depends on valac. Ensures that the vapi files can be rebuilt. * Run wrap-and-sort * debian/control: - Remove obsolete versioned dependency, Breaks, and Replaces. - Update Standards-Version to 4.0.0. - Remove Build-Depends on dh-autoreconf. It's included with debhelper 10. - Change libgexiv2-dev from Multi-Arch foreign to same. * Update symbols file: - Add new symbol and remove private symbols which upstream has marked as hidden. - Dynamically associate C++ symbols with current version. These are private symbols and not part of the ABI. Dynamically generate a symbols file giving all of them the current library version. This prevents new C++ symbols from causing warnings. * Update debian/copyright. Update copyrights and change Format to use https url. Regards, Jason Crain